Ir para conteúdo

POWERED BY:

Arquivado

Este tópico foi arquivado e está fechado para novas respostas.

FabioRubim

Usando o Firebird

Recommended Posts

Olá pessoal, não sei se é o melhor local para postar isso, mas vamos lá....Você usam muito firebird com Delphi? o que acham dele?E essa é mais geral de banco dados... pelo que ja li o melhor é quando criarmos um campo que ira receber número e não for feito cálculos com ele, é melhor criar como tipo texto, é correto isso? pois o ruim é que ai quando for um índice e for numerando em alguma ordem, vai ser classificado como texto, não como número....Abraços!

Compartilhar este post


Link para o post
Compartilhar em outros sites

Bom, no meu ver depende, pois no caso de armazenar um campo em string precisa cuidar se vai ser varchr ou char, e ainda pode ficar com um trabalho dobrado de ficar convertendo os números, não sei muito bem no caso do firebird, mas dependendo do banco, você pode criar o campo inteiro e definir um tamanho para ele, assim poupando espaço, e como você mesmo mencionou, no momento de indexação é mais rápido com campos inteiros...Já usei o firebird por um bom tempo, no meu ponto de vista o melhor free atualmente do mercado... gosto muito... dependendo do tamanho do seu BD vale a pena verificar...

Compartilhar este post


Link para o post
Compartilhar em outros sites

no caso estou usando varchar, acho que esssas chaves primárias não irá ser preciso converter...e... o principal problema é que ai fica ordenado como texto, não como número, o que era para ficar assim:

12..101112..2021..3031

fica assim:

110220330..

isso não tem como resolver no bd né?obrigado!

Compartilhar este post


Link para o post
Compartilhar em outros sites

×

Informação importante

Ao usar o fórum, você concorda com nossos Termos e condições.